"Desperate Search Intensifies for Vanished High School Coach"

The shocking disappearance of Union High School's head football coach, Travis Turner, has left a cloud of uncertainty hanging over what was anticipated to be a victorious, unbeaten season for the team in Virginia. Turner, aged 46, was officially reported as missing by the Virginia State Police after he was last seen on Thursday. Clad in a gray sweatshirt, gray sweatpants, and glasses, his whereabouts remain unknown, prompting a flurry of search efforts and a sense of unease in the community.

Amid the intensifying search for Turner, suspicions were raised further when Wise County Public Schools disclosed that an unidentified staff member had been put on administrative leave with pay pending an internal investigation following external allegations. The dynamics surrounding Turner's disappearance and the additional inquiry have deepened the mystery, leaving many questions unanswered and the community on edge.

State police responded to a non-criminal complaint at Turner's residence near Appalachia, Virginia, on Thursday evening, only to find him absent upon arrival. Turner's wife, Leslie Turner, took to Facebook in a now-deleted post lamenting his disappearance, leaving readers with a sense of urgency and concern for his well-being. Search efforts with the aid of K-9 units, drones, and ground crews have been tirelessly underway in the hope of locating Turner swiftly.

Turner's sudden vanishing has sent shockwaves through the Big Stone Gap community and the Union High School Bears, who were heading into the postseason with an impressive 11-0 record. As the head football coach at the school since 2011, Turner's absence has left a void in both the team and the spirit of the community.

While details regarding the circumstances of Turner's disappearance and the initial complaint remain under wraps, there has been no indication of suspected foul play by officials. The lack of concrete information has only heightened the sense of urgency in finding Turner and unraveling the mystery that surrounds his sudden absence.

The community's support and hope for Turner's safe return have been unwavering, with Virginia State Police spearheading the search efforts. Jay Edwards, the school's assistant coach, has taken charge of coaching responsibilities in Turner's absence as the search intensifies and hope for his safe return remains high.
